Analysis

The most recent figure for potassium chloride (muriate of potash) (mop) — export quantity in South America (excluding intra-trade) is 294,825 t, measured in 2024.

The figure is up 28.3% on the previous year and down 64.1% over ten years.

Over the whole period, potassium chloride (muriate of potash) (mop) — export quantity in South America (excluding intra-trade) peaked at 1.02 million t in 2010 and was at its lowest, 714.95 t, in 2004.

That places South America (excluding intra-trade) 18th out of 31 groups with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

Potassium chloride (muriate of potash) (MOP) — Export quantity in South America (excluding intra-trade), year by year

Annual values for Potassium chloride (muriate of potash) (MOP) — Export quantity in South America (excluding intra-trade), 2002 to 2024.
Year t Change
2002 45,040 t
2003 31,666 t -29.7%
2004 714.95 t -97.7%
2005 2,407 t +236.6%
2006 3,058 t +27.1%
2007 31,714 t +937.2%
2008 51,537 t +62.5%
2009 304,632 t +491.1%
2010 1.02 million t +233.7%
2011 782,100 t -23.1%
2012 729,588 t -6.7%
2013 912,546 t +25.1%
2014 821,061 t -10.0%
2015 851,410 t +3.7%
2016 920,104 t +8.1%
2017 687,463 t -25.3%
2018 483,246 t -29.7%
2019 240,766 t -50.2%
2020 266,508 t +10.7%
2021 278,314 t +4.4%
2022 272,969 t -1.9%
2023 229,809 t -15.8%
2024 294,825 t +28.3%

The Fertilizers by Product dataset contains information on the Production, Trade and Agriculture Use of inorganic (chemical or mineral) fertilizers products. The fertilizer statistics data are for a set of 23 product categories. Both straight and compound fertilizers are included.
